[QUOTE="giannis, post: 189961, member: 3743"] I was getting ready for this hunt for about a year or more shooting long range up to 700 yards and ended up shooting this nice whitetail at only 80 but i guess it doesnt matter dead is dead Anyway i was hunting with bearpaw outfitters out of peace river alberta a couple of guys from here been there, it was the best place i have seen so far, a lot of deer , nice camp , good people , good guides and the best food i ever had in a hunting camp I will try to post a picture of that deer if i remember how to do it i was using my 300 win mag with 180 nosler abt wich worked very well the deer droped in his tracks he was quartering away and the bullet went in behind the last rib and exited thru the front shoulder [img]http://www.hunt101.com/data/500/thumbs/Greek2.JPG[/img] [/QUOTE]
